About Gumanpur Village
Gumanpur is a mid sized village in Chhuikhadan tehsil, in the district of Rajnandgaon, Chhattisgarh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 697, made up of 337 males and 360 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,068 females per 1000 males. The village covers 287.09 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 491888,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Gumanpur
The census records public bus service for Gumanpur as Available. Private bus service is recorded as Available within <5 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
